(4) SQL編碼
數(shù)據(jù)庫系統(tǒng)作為數(shù)據(jù)管理的一個平臺,在日常工作中所有的操作及交互都需要使用SQL進行。因此SQL的編寫是運維人員必須具備的能力,在此基礎(chǔ)上還要了解怎樣的SQL可以讓數(shù)據(jù)庫引擎高效地執(zhí)行。對于SQL Server的數(shù)據(jù)庫引擎來說,復(fù)雜的SQL往往執(zhí)行效率不高,調(diào)試?yán)щy,無法重復(fù)使用。復(fù)雜的存儲過程同樣面對閱讀困難、復(fù)用性差以及不便維護的困境。因此應(yīng)該盡可能地使用較為簡單的SQL,合理地將SQL或存儲過程進行拆分,簡化邏輯。此外數(shù)據(jù)庫引擎對于大批量的數(shù)據(jù)處理效率要優(yōu)于行級數(shù)據(jù)處理,在維護過程中要多加注意。